Please enable JavaScript.
Coggle requires JavaScript to display documents.
ToskrMail, Mail Dashboard sync structure - Coggle Diagram
ToskrMail
Mail Dashboard sync structure
API's available
/backend/imap/get_mails
get_mails
/backend/imap/update_data_in_redis
update_redis
/backend/imap/read_labels
Mail Dashboard
Pages
first time for each page(browser refresh or first visit)
get_mails
get mails forcurrent folder / page only
on every 1 minute ( if user stay in mail dashboard page)
update_redis
update current folder / page only
mail dasbhoard hard refresh
update_redis
update current folder / page only
Actions
Delete Mails
after successful delete from trash folder
update_redis
update trash folder / page only
after successful delete form other folder (which will move the mail to trash)
update_redis
update the source folder / page ( from where the mail move to trash folder)
update_redis
update trash folder / page only
Forward Mail
after successful forward
update_redis
update sent folder / page only
Reply Mail
after successful reply
update_redis
update sent folder / page only
Move to Folder
after successful move
update_redis
update source folder / page from where the mail move to target folder
update_redis
update target folder / page
Page navigation
get_mails
get mails from current folder / page
compose mail
Draft Mail
after successful sav draft or delete draft
update_redis
update draft folder / page only
after successful mail sent
update_redis
update sent folder / page only
user onboarding
after successful onboarding
update_redis
update inbox mail only
default sso
Follow UP
Follow Out Forward
after successful forward
update_redis
update sent folder / page only